I’ve personally experienced “hammer-follow” while shooting a 100% original, absolutely no modifications or after-market parts Colt AR-15 (not mine, by the way, so please, Mr. ATF agent, don’t go knocking down my door tomorrow night).  It was sorta funny at first, having the rifle blip off two rounds at random, but it’s also a little nerve-racking to think that some busybody might squeal because you have a “machine gun” at the range.  If you have a similar problem, it’s best to get it fixed asap.  machinegun
